We often discuss our favorite Bond movies, our favorite Bond actors, our favorite Bond girls, etc.

 

But what about our favorite scene(s) in a Bond movie?  When you think back on your Bond watching experience, are there certain scenes that always (or often) come to mind - for whatever reason - perhaps they are visually appealing, perhaps the cinemetography really stands out, the emotional attachment is high, the Bondian "feel" is shouting at you. 

 

So what are your favorite scenes in the Bond movies?  List as many as you might want.  The scenes can be short or long, but list the scene, the movie, and what that scene stands out as most memorable.

 

Here are a few of mine...

 

SKYFALL - the lights moving across the glass panes as Bond sneaks up on Patrice - amazing visually.

 

TSWLM - XXX entering the club in her black dress - gorgeous!

 

GE - Pierce's entrance as Bond running across the top of the dam wall - first Bond moment to watch on film.

 

DN - Bond first introducing himself as "Bond, James Bond" - classic Bond moment.

 

More to follow.  What about your favorite Bond scenes?

DN: "Bond, James Bond' ; Dent killing

FRWL: PTS, 'she should have kept her mouth shut', Fight on train

GF: PTS, Q sequence, 'No, Mr Bond, I expect, you too die'

TB: Flowers on Bouvard, Killing of Vargas

YOLT: Meeting with Tiger

OHMSS: PTS, Meeting with Draco, Ski Chase, death of Tracy

DAF: Fight in the elevator

LALD: Bond in black with a 44

TMWGG: Bond 'questionning' Andrea

TSWLM: PTS, Bond and Anya at the Mujaba Club, Combat on the tanker, Death of Stromberg

MR: PTS, Corinne death + shooting just before

FYEO: 2CV car chase, Bond meeting Colombo, the Meteor escalade

OP: PTS, 009 death, Bond as a clown + the whole pursuit before starting on the train

AVTAK: Sequence in Chantilly and dialogs with Tibet (absolutely non bondian but fun)

TLD: PTS, Sniper scene, Necros delivering milk

LTK: Sanchez escape + torturing Leiter, death of Killifer, Waterski behind the plane, Truck chase

GE: Dam Jump, 007 & Janus meeting in the park, Bond escaping in Saint Peterbourg (until Tank chase)

TND: PTS, 'I am just a professionnal doing a job - me too'

TWINE: PTS, Fight against choppers, Killing of Electra

DAD: PTS, Cuba until Halle Berry shows up (actually - just after Halle Berry shows up)

CR: PTS, 'parkhour chase', Miami Chase, Poker game, 'Bitch is dead' line, the very end

QoS: Bond looking for stationnery

SF: fight with Patrice in Shanghai - the very end in the old office
